Grant CommentsOutput power listed is conducted. The antenna installation and operating configurations of this transmitter, including any applicable source-based time-averaging duty factor, antenna gain and cable loss must satisfy MPE categorical Exclusion Requirements of §2.1091. The antenna(s) used for this transmitter must be installed to provide a separation distance of at least 20 cm from all persons and must not be co-located or operating in conjunction with any other antenna or transmitter. To meet EIRP limit, the gain of antenna used with this amplifier must be offset by the cable loss. Users and installers must be provided with antenna installation instructions and transmitter operating conditions for satisfying RF exposure compliance.
